Is Underdog Fantasy legal?
Yes, Underdog Fantasy is legal in many U.S. states as a daily fantasy sports (DFS) platform, including major markets like California, Texas, New York, and Florida. However, availability varies by game type, with Underdog Pick’em and College Pick’em restricted or unavailable in certain states depending on local DFS regulations.

Despite its name, Underdog Fantasy is no underdog in the world of daily fantasy sports. At present, Underdog Fantasy is accessible in numerous states across the United States, but it's important to note that not every fantasy game on the Underdog platform is available in all legal states.
You can play Underdog Fantasy in many U.S. states where daily fantasy sports are permitted, as long as you are physically located in an eligible state and meet the minimum age requirement, which is usually 18 or older.
At the time of writing, Underdog Fantasy is available to players aged 18+ in a wide range of states, including:
Underdog operates as a daily fantasy sports (DFS) platform, not a sportsbook, which allows it to be offered in states where DFS contests are legal but sports betting may not be.

Below is a summary of U.S. states Underdog is legal in:
State | Underdog Fantasy Drafts | Underdog Fantasy Pick’em | Underdog Fantasy College Pick’em |
|---|---|---|---|
Alabama | ✅ | ✅ | ✅ |
Alaska | ✅ | ✅ | ✅ |
Arizona | ✅ | ✅ | ❌ |
Arkansas | ✅ | ✅ | ❌ |
California | ✅ | ✅ | ✅ |
Colorado | ✅ | ✅ | ✅ |
Connecticut | ❌ | ❌ | ❌ |
Delaware | ❌ | ❌ | ❌ |
Florida | ✅ | ✅ | ✅ |

Hawaii | ❌ | ❌ | ❌ |
Idaho | ❌ | ❌ | ❌ |
Illinois | ✅ | ✅ | ✅ |
Indiana | ✅ | ✅ | ❌ |
Iowa | ❌ | ❌ | ❌ |
Kansas | ✅ | ✅ | ✅ |
Kentucky | ✅ | ✅ | ✅ |
Louisiana | ❌ | ❌ | ❌ |
Maine | ❌ | ❌ | ❌ |
Maryland | ✅ | ❌ | ❌ |
Massachusetts | ✅ | ✅ | ❌ |
Michigan | ✅ | ❌ | ❌ |
Minnesota | ✅ | ✅ | ✅ |
Mississippi | ✅ | ❌ | ❌ |
Missouri | ✅ | ✅ | ✅ |
Montana | ❌ | ❌ | ❌ |
Nebraska | ✅ | ✅ | ✅ |
Nevada | ❌ | ❌ | ❌ |
New Hampshire | ✅ | ✅ | ❌ |
New Jersey | ✅ | ❌ | ❌ |
New Mexico | ✅ | ✅ | ✅ |
New York | ✅ | ✅ | ❌ |
North Carolina | ✅ | ✅ | ✅ |
North Dakota | ✅ | ✅ | ✅ |
Ohio | ✅ | ❌ | ❌ |
Oklahoma | ✅ | ✅ | ✅ |
Oregon | ✅ | ✅ | ✅ |
Pennsylvania | ✅ | ❌ | ❌ |
Rhode Island | ✅ | ✅ | ✅ |
South Carolina | ✅ | ✅ | ✅ |
South Dakota | ✅ | ✅ | ✅ |
Tennessee | ✅ | ✅ | ❌ |

Utah | ✅ | ✅ | ✅ |
Vermont | ✅ | ✅ | ❌ |
Virginia | ✅ | ✅ | ✅ |
Washington | ❌ | ❌ | ❌ |
Washington, D.C. | ✅ | ✅ | ✅ |
West Virginia | ✅ | ✅ | ✅ |
Wisconsin | ✅ | ✅ | ✅ |
Wyoming | ✅ | ✅ | ✅ |
As you can see, the legality of Underdog Fantasy in the United States is a bit complicated, with some states imposing restrictions on certain types of contests. However, we'll go ahead and do our best to break it down and help simplify things for you.
Underdog Fantasy Drafts (Best Ball, Battle Royale, etc.) are currently available in 40 of the 50 U.S. states, along with Washington, D.C.

Of those 40 states, 34 also have access to Underdog Fantasy Pick'em Contests. However, Underdog Fantasy College Pick'em Contests are off-limits in eight of the 34 eligible U.S. states (AK, AZ, IN, MA, NH, NY, TN, & VT).

In addition, Underdog Fantasy is available in nearly all of Canada. 12 of the 13 Canadian provinces and territories currently have access to all types of Underdog Fantasy contests, with Ontario being the only exception.

Underdog Fantasy is also one of the best in the business when it comes to providing exciting bonuses and promotions to both new and existing users.
For example, the platform typically offers a deposit match bonus for all new users to help boost their initial bankroll and reward players for joining the community.
In addition, referral bonuses are offered for inviting friends to join in on the excitement at Underdog Fantasy.
Players will also enjoy frequent Multiplier Boosts and Specials for Pick'em Contests. Multiplier boosts offer greater payouts for successful picks, while Specials increase your chances of winning by providing heavily-adjusted, user-friendly lines for your picks.
Underdog Fantasy provides its users with convenient options for both deposits and withdrawals. When it comes to funding your account, you can choose between two primary methods: Debit/Credit Cards (Visa, Mastercard, Discover, and American Express) or PayPal.
On the withdrawal side, Underdog Fantasy offers two reliable options. You can cash out your winnings directly to your PayPal account, with funds typically arriving in 2-3 business days.
Alternatively, Interchecks enables various withdrawal methods, including eChecks, paper checks, direct deposits, virtual prepaid cards, and plastic prepaid cards.

What States Is Underdog Fantasy Legal in?
Underdog Fantasy is currently legal in 40 of the 50 U.S. states. Connecticut, Delaware, Hawaii, Idaho, Iowa, Louisiana, Maine, Montana, Nevada, and Washington are the only exceptions. In addition, Underdog Fantasy is available in 12 of 13 Canadian provinces and territories (all but Ontario).
Is Underdog Fantasy Legit?
Yes, Underdog Fantasy is generally considered a legitimate Daily Fantasy Sports (DFS) platform, operating in approved states with licenses, secure transactions, and compliance systems but it has faced criticism and legal scrutiny in certain jurisdictions.
Who Can Use Underdog Fantasy?
There are two key requirements you must meet in order to sign up and enter paid contests on Underdog Fantasy. First, you must be physically located in an eligible U.S. state or Canadian province/territory. Second, you must meet the minimum age requirements in your state or jurisdiction, which is 18 years old in most cases (but 19 in Alabama and Nebraska, and 21 in Arizona and Massachusetts).
Does Underdog Fantasy actually payout?
Yes, Underdog Fantasy does pay out real money to players who win eligible contests, as long as account verification is complete and all contest rules are followed. Withdrawals are available once winnings are cleared.
